How a Personal Injury Lawyer Can Help You Avoid Debt

In the United States, medical debt is the largest cause of bankruptcy. Medical bills account for more than half of all debt collected in the United States. Being seriously injured might follow you for the rest of your life. With initial treatment costing hundreds of thousands of dollars, it’s no wonder that people who have been injured fall into debt. Many patients will use their credit cards to pay for these bills so that their debt doesn’t go to collections. It is a short-term solution that costs thousands of dollars in interest down the line.

When it comes to medical debt after an accident, there are many elements at play. Consulting an expert attorney is the best approach to safeguard your rights and financial security. A personal injury lawyer will know how to deal with your insurance company and whoever caused your accident. They will also deal with everyone else involved in your accident and medical care.

A personal injury lawyer is someone who helps people who have been hurt in an accident get the legal help they need. They work in tort law, which includes both negligent and intentional actions. They help seek compensation for accident victims.

An accident can cause a catastrophic injury that requires extensive care. It can prevent you from going to work and can be financially devastating. Even financially stable people can fall into medical debt after a major accident. Medical debt can form because of the gap between the actual treatment cost and what your insurance covers. More often than not, insurance covers only a part of the enormous treatment costs. Here are a few ways how a personal injury lawyer can help you avoid debt:

  • A lawyer can gather evidence to strengthen your case

A personal injury lawyer may gather evidence that will support your claim. It may include obtaining any police or incident reports. They may go out of their way to find witnesses and get witness testimonies. They may also gather case evidence, such as property damage, video footage, etc. Lawyers may use evidence to prove the person who caused the accident is guilty and the extent of your losses. This evidence may include medical reports, medical records, bills, employment documents, employment reports, and property damage reports.

  • With the help of a personal injury lawyer, you may stand to receive a larger settlement

The guilty party’s insurance representative deals with these types of cases on a daily basis. They can be quite persuasive when bargaining for a reduced payout. Negotiating with insurance companies can be difficult; they have ways of convincing you to accept their first offer. This is why you need the help of an experienced lawyer during this time. Hiring a personal injury lawyer after being hurt often results in higher compensation.

  • An attorney can help you better negotiate with insurance firms

Typically, insurance firms have the deck loaded in their favor. They have a lot of money and a lot of legal resources. When working with these organizations, you want to ensure that you are on an equal playing field.

As an injury victim, your goal is to seek maximum compensation for your injuries. After an accident, you may have major medical bills or extensive property damage. In this scenario, you owe it to yourself and your future to do everything in your power to get the best deal you can. An insurance adjuster will most likely have the upper hand over you if you do it alone. They are well-versed in the law. They understand how to persuade you that a low-ball offer is in your best interests when it isn’t. A skilled attorney will intervene, and deal with the insurance company on your behalf. They will help level the playing field through skillful bargaining to prove the genuine value of your case.

  • A lawyer can also help you get paid faster

If you do not have a lawyer, you must wait until you have recovered before seeking compensation. So, you will have to wait longer to receive your compensation. You should contact a personal injury attorney as soon as possible following your accident. This allows them to submit personal injury claims on your behalf while you recover. An experienced personal injury lawyer will have the expertise to deal with a case like yours and be familiar with the laws involved in such cases. So, they can avoid all setbacks and assist you in receiving compensation as soon as possible.
